Wednesday, May 8, 2024
HomeJavaScriptThe Ember Occasions - Concern No. 92

The Ember Occasions – Concern No. 92


હેલો Emberistas! 🐹

The video recordings of EmberConf 2019 are actually obtainable! However first, examine the advantages of volunteering at a tech convention 💪, an RFC on including npm dependency lint ✨, a brand new {{fn}} Helper RFC 🎉, knowledge loading and animation patterns in your Ember app 🌟, and you do not wanna miss tips about mentoring Ember builders 👩‍🏫! Take pleasure in some ✨ fan artwork by @delusioninabox 👩‍🎨, and skim the unique interview with Ember contributor @pzuraq! 💬


@lisaychuang shares her expertise from this 12 months’s EmberConf, and encourages newcomers in any tech group to attend a tech convention (and probably volunteer!).

As a volunteer, you may get:

  • A heat welcome to the group
  • Behind the scene entry
  • A chill residence base through the convention

Curious to be taught extra? Try her submit on Medium: 3 explanation why it is best to volunteer at a tech convention.


@Alonski proposed that the addon ember-cli-dependency-lint must be added to the default blueprint.

This lint helps us detect early if our addons depend on the identical bundle however use completely different variations. In such circumstances, Ember CLI merges all variations into one. This may trigger our app to behave unexpectedly and turn into exhausting to debug. 😨😰😱

You may study ember-cli-dependency-lint addon and how you can resolve dependency conflicts at https://github.com/salsify/ember-cli-dependency-lint. You’ll want to go away your feedback on the present proposal.


Try the {{fn}} Helper RFC opened by @rtablada that introduces clear argument passing for capabilities in templates.

The {{fn}} RFC ought to remedy for among the complexity and confusion across the present motion helper. The brand new {{fn}} helper will soak up a perform and set of arguments which can be partially utilized to the perform (without having for construct time non-public APIs), and context binding shall be accomplished utilizing the @motion decorator in courses.

For extra on the detailed design of the proposal, together with comparisons to the motion helper/modifier and a few options see the total RFC.


@ijlee2, a primary time attendee at EmberConf, shares a tutorial on how you can load complicated knowledge in a predictable method and how you can use animations to brighten up your Ember functions.

The tutorial covers how one can make animations utilizing Ember Animated and Internet Animations API to assist make your functions really feel extra dynamic and polished!

One other fascinating space the tutorial explores is predictable knowledge loading, overcoming bugs that you could be encounter when having fashions and relationships and the way you should use Ember Knowledge Storefront to help tackling a few of this points! Positively value trying out!

Learn the full article alongside some video previews or try a preview of the demo app from the tutorial.


Whereas realizing she’s now not a newbie, @danielleadams paperwork her ideas on what extra skilled builders can do to assist these newer to the tech business and dealing as builders. Try her weblog submit on the topic, stemming from her expertise being a mentor at EmberConf!


Should you missed the prospect to see talks from EmberConf 2019, fear no extra! Beginning right this moment, you may watch all of them on YouTube. Please upvote the movies and share them along with your groups, communities, household, and buddies! 💜


@delusioninabox created a comedian about having the ability to work with Ember once more after a very long time away. Like, retweet, or touch upon the submit on Twitter!


Chris Garrett

Within the ninth version of the contributor interview collection, group member Chris Garrett, often known as @pzuraq, talks about his story getting concerned with native courses and decorators in Ember. Chris additionally explains why everybody locally is keen to assist make your contribution an actual success as properly ✨

You may learn the total interview on the Ember Discussion board.

Learn extra


This week we would prefer to thank @Turbo87, @yohanmishkin, @chancancode, @cibernox, @bartocc, @pzuraq, @krisselden, @chadhietala, @rwjblue, @runspired, @raulb, @efx, @dcyriller, @igorT, @rwwagner90, @danwenzel, @toddjordan, @dayton-bobbitt, @kennethlarsen, @jenweber, @dfreeman, @scalvert, @czosel, @RichardOtvos, @dmzza, @ClaytonTurner, @mdbiscan, @zachgarwood and @Charizard for his or her contributions to Ember and associated repositories! 💖


Office Hours Tomster Mascot

Questioning about one thing associated to Ember, Ember Knowledge, Glimmer, or addons within the Ember ecosystem, however do not know the place to ask? Readers’ Questions are only for you!

Submit your personal quick and candy query underneath bit.ly/ask-ember-core. And don’t fear, there aren’t any foolish questions, we admire all of them – promise! 🤞


Need to write for the Ember Occasions? Have a suggestion for subsequent week’s subject? Be part of us at #support-ember-times on the Ember Group Discord or ping us @embertimes on Twitter.

Carry on high of what is been happening in Emberland this week by subscribing to our e-mail publication! You can even discover our posts on the Ember weblog.


That is one other wrap! ✨

Be form,

Chris Ng, Lisa Huang-North, Jessica Jordan, Isaac Lee, Danielle Adams, Amy Lam, Bradley Leftley, Jared Galanis and the Studying Crew



RELATED ARTICLES

LEAVE A REPLY

Please enter your comment!
Please enter your name here

Most Popular

Recent Comments